Compare A Portrait of Britain in the Middle Ages 1066-1485 by Mary Roper Author Price, Hardcover | Indigo Chapters
Mary Roper Author Price
$44.50
A Portrait of Britain in the Middle Ages 1066-1485 by Mary Roper Author Price, Hardcover | Indigo Chapters